Frequently Asked Questions about Indian Creek

What type of rentals are currently available in Indian Creek?

There are currently 92 Apartments for Rent in Indian Creek, AR with pricing that ranges from $850 to $6,190. There are also 59 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Indian Creek ranging from $925 to $3,950.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Indian Creek?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Indian Creek ranges from $925 to $3,950 with an average monthly rent of $2,227.
